When selecting a hot beverage vending machine for your business, consider several key features. A temperature control system is crucial. Beverages need to be served at optimal temperatures. According to a 2022 market report, 78% of consumers prefer their coffee above 160°F. Without precise control, you'll disappoint customers.
Customization options are also important. A good machine should offer a variety of drinks, including tea, coffee, and hot chocolate. Data shows that 65% of consumers appreciate choices tailored to their preferences. Machines that allow for personal adjustments in sweetness and milk options tend to attract more users.
Another feature to evaluate is energy efficiency. Machines that conserve energy save costs. A 2023 sustainability report noted that energy-efficient vending machines can reduce electricity usage by up to 30%. However, not all models meet these standards. It’s vital to research and compare specifications. Some machines may tout efficiency but fall short in real-world scenarios.

When considering a hot beverage vending machine, evaluating costs is crucial. The initial investment can vary widely. Basic machines are often more affordable, but they might lack desirable features. Higher-end units usually offer better customization options and superior beverage choices. You need to assess what fits your budget and business needs.
Beyond purchase costs, ongoing expenses matter. Think about ingredients, maintenance, and energy consumption. Prices can add up quickly. Tracking usage can help identify which beverages are popular and which might need to be replaced. This data can guide future decisions and adjustments.
Return on investment (ROI) is a key consideration. A machine should ideally generate more revenue than it costs to run. Simple calculations are not always enough. Regularly reviewing sales against costs is necessary. You may find surprising trends. Experimenting with new drinks can also stimulate interest and boost sales. Flexibility in approach is important for optimizing success.

When choosing a vending machine for hot beverages, maintenance and support play a crucial role. Regular upkeep ensures optimal performance. It can prevent unexpected breakdowns that disrupt service. Keeping track of maintenance schedules is vital. A machine that remains out of service can lead to lost sales and dissatisfied customers.
Consider the availability of support from the supplier. Some suppliers offer 24/7 assistance, which is beneficial during emergencies. However, not all support is equal. Some suppliers may have slow response times. This is something to watch for when selecting a vending machine. Easy access to replacement parts is also essential. Delayed repairs can create long-term issues.
